The CHAMBERLAIN myQ Smart Outdoor Wired Camera offers 1080p HD video with a 130º wide-angle and 360º swivel lens, enhanced by infrared color night vision for clear images day and night. Designed for all-weather durability (-4ºF to 122ºF), it integrates seamlessly with myQ smart locks and garage doors to proactively secure your home by automatically locking and closing access points when motion is detected during preset times. Easy Bluetooth setup, two-way communication, and intelligent alerts with up to 30 days of event storage make it a comprehensive, professional-grade security solution.

Great camera but does not integrate with Alexa
This is a great camera with good image quality both day and night. I bought the indoor camera for my garage, liked it a lot so I bought 3 outdoor cameras to replace my Arlo cameras.Setup was relatively painless. The camera was discovered by the app right away, connected to wi-fi and updated easily. The camera is installed with relative ease if your goal is to mount on a wall and just plug it in. There is about 15-20ft of wire with weatherproof fittings on both ends. If you are desiring a more refined installation with shorter or hidden wiring, you will need to drill, cut wire and solder in a new usb-a plug to your custom length of wire. It would be nice if Chamberlain designed a professional install kit to facilitate neater installation.Note: you will need the $99/yr 30-day all device storage subscription to be able to record your video. Not a bad deal if you are doing a multiple device installation. I have 5 video devices setup so it’s totally worth the price.My sole issue with the MyQ product line is that it does not integrate with Alexa. This make absolutely no sense to me since MyQ supports Amazon Key delivery. I would buy the new MyQ doorbell but not if it does not integrate with Alexa.

May be finicky with your 2.4 mhz network-no 5g but a very good camera
It is a nice camera with excellent picture. I took it to work, and across the street to my neighbor's to try to connect it to their 5 mhz networks. I could not. I took it back home and added a 2.4 to my router but no go. I have a Mesh 2.4 network but no go there either. I had a small travel router that I use. I added that to my switch, got a signal, and the camera connected to the travel router's 2.4 network. I have two other cameras where I had to do that. I do have the keypad and it connected fine to my Mesh network. So did two other cameras. It seems the newer cameras are finicky. However, I got them connected, they work, I have access on my app and it is not an issue for me to use a subnet. Excellent resolution, good night vision. I would buy it again; in fact, I will.
